#67b152 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#67b152 is composed of 40.4% red, 69.4% green and 32.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 41.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 53.7% yellow and 30.6% black. It has a hue angle of 106.7 degrees, a saturation of 37.8% and a lightness of 50.8%. #67b152 color hex could be obtained by blending #ceffa4 with #006300. Closest websafe color is: #669966.

● #67b152 color description : Dark moderate lime green.
The hexadecimal color #67b152 has RGB values of R:103, G:177, B:82 and CMYK values of C:0.42, M:0, Y:0.54,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 6795602.
